Fire Erupts at St. Mark’s Catholic School in Hounslow
Chaos hit St. Mark’s Catholic School on Bath Road this morning as a fire broke out in one of the classrooms. Four fire engines and around 25 firefighters rushed to tackle the blaze after smoke was spotted billowing from a single-storey block.
Swift Evacuation Saves Hundreds
The emergency call came in at 9:04am, and crews from Heston and Feltham fire stations were on site in minutes. Thanks to a quick-thinking evacuation, about 1,400 staff and students were safely out of the building before the fire brigade arrived.
